#2f398f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f398f is composed of 18.4% red, 22.4%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 60.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 233.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 37.3%. #2f398f color hex could be obtained by blending #5e72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#2f398f color description : Dark moderate blue.
#2f398f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f398f has RGB values of R:47, G:57,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3094927.
